/rɪwˈɔrdɪd/ /riwˈɔrdəd/ /riwˈɔrdɪd/ Listen  verb Reward v. t. (past & past part. rewarded; pres. part. rewarding) To give in return, whether good or evil; commonly in a good sense; to requite; to recompense; to repay; to compensate. "After the deed that is done, one doom shall reward, Mercy or no mercy as truth will accord." "Thou hast rewarded me good, whereas I have rewarded thee evil." "I will render vengeance to mine enemies, and will reward them that hate me." "God rewards those that have made use of the single talent."
